Across TCGA patient cohorts, ZDHHC21 protein abundance is significantly associated with the RNA expression of many other genes, with 2,682 significant associations in total. LUAD shows the largest number of these associations.

The most reproducible ZDHHC21-associated genes across cancer lineages are CDCA4P1, FUBP3, and VDR. Each is linked with ZDHHC21 in more than 2 cancer types. Because this analysis shows association rather than direction, both ZDHHC21-to-partner and partner-to-ZDHHC21 results are reported.
